Impact of Lynch Syndrome, BRAFV600E, and RAS Mutations on Outcomes in MSI/dMMR Metastatic Colorectal Cancer (mcrc) Treated with Immune Checkpoint Inhibitors (ICI): Analysis of Combined International Cohorts.

171 Background: ICI have demonstrated efficacy in patients (pts) with MSI/dMMR mCRC . Lynch (LS) vs sporadic (Sp) status, BRAFV600E and RAS mutations (mt) are known factors of clinical and molecular heterogeneity in this population. We aimed to evaluate the prognostic value of these parameters in ICI-treated MSI mCRC pts. Methods: Pts are drawn from international cohorts (France, Italy, Spain, and USA). Pts were considered to have cancer linked to LS only in case of determined germline mutation and Sp in case of loss of MLH1/PMS2 protein expression associated with BRAF V600E mutation and/or hypermethylation of MLH1 promoter, or in case of biallelic somatic mutations of MMR genes. Survival analyses: progression-free survival (PFS) per iRECIST criteria and overall survival (OS) were adjusted on prognostic modifiers, selected on unadjusted analysis (p < 0.2) in case of limited number of events. Results: On the 466 pts included, 112 (24%) received ICI in first line, 305 (65%) received anti-PD1 alone, 161 (35%) anti-PD1 plus anti-CTLA4, 129 (29%) had BRAFV600Emt and 153 (34%) RASmt. Median follow-up was 24.0 months. In adjusted analysis of the whole population (n=466; 186 PFS events and 143 OS events), no association with PFS and OS was observed for BRAFV600E mt (PFS HR 1.20 [0.80 to 1.79], p=0.372; OS HR 1.06 [0.66 to 1.70], p= 0.811) and RASmt (PFS HR 0.93 [0.64 to 1.36], p= 0.712; OS HR 0.75 [0.48 to 1.17] p= 0.202). Adjusting factors were age, ECOG status, number of prior chemotherapies, treatment type (bi vs monotherapy), sidness (right vs left + rectum), primary tumor surgery. Concerning the population with determined Lynch status (n= 242; 83 PFS events and 54 OS events), PFS results are displayed. The analysis of impact of LS was not adjusted on BRAFV600E mutational status due to collinearity. In adjusted analysis, LS improved PFS compared with Sp (HR = 0.49, 95%CI (0.25 to 0.96), p = 0.036). Adjusted HR for OS was 0.56 without reaching significance 95%CI (0.25 to 1.22), p = 0.143. Conclusions: In this analysis of ICI-treated MSI/dMMR mCRC pts, RAS/BRAFV600E mutations are not associated with survival while Lynch syndrome pts demonstrated improved PFS. [Table: see text]
